Jeanine Jackson Biography ((?)-)

  • CREDITS
  • Television Appearances
  • Series
  • Mindy Hardeman, Against the Grain, NBC, 1993-1994
  • Livie Ann (Jeff's boss), The Jeff Foxworthy Show (also known as Somewhere in America), NBC, 1996-1997
  • Movies
  • First reporter, Convicted, ABC, 1986
  • Marie, Out on the Edge, CBS, 1989
  • Mother, Little White Lies, NBC, 1989
  • Mrs. Oberg, The Story Lady, NBC, 1991
  • Rural doctor, Heartbeat (also known as Danielle Steel's "Heartbeat"), NBC, 1993
  • Second fan, Dad, the Angel & Me, The Family Channel, 1995
  • Angela, Breast Men, HBO, 1997
  • Christine Schofield, A Thousand Men and a Baby (also known as Narrow Escape), CBS, 1997
  • Emily, Childhood Sweetheart?, CBS, 1997
  • Marion, Love Is Strange, Lifetime, 1999
  • Episodic
  • Dana, "Suzanne Goes Looking for a Friend," Designing Women, CBS, 1990
  • Dr. Catherine Potter, "Shark Derby," Baywatch, NBC, 1990
  • Mary Anne, "Fraternity Reunion," Full House, ABC, 1990
  • Annabelle, "Nothing Says Lovin'...," Amen, NBC, 1991
  • Kelly, "The Leap Back--June 15, 1945," Quantum Leap, NBC, 1991
  • Laura, "Retreat," Murphy Brown, CBS, 1991
  • Roxanne, "The Apartment," Seinfeld, NBC, 1991
  • Voice of Baby Sophie, "Whiz Kid," Baby Talk, ABC, 1991
  • Janine Flynt, "Stormy Weather: Part 1," Jake and the Fatman, CBS,1992
  • Melissa Brulay, "Honeymoon in L.A.: Part 2," A Different World, NBC, 1992
  • Mom, "Taking a Stand," Kids Incorporated, The Disney Channel, 1993
  • Mother, "Change for a Buck," Married ... with Children, Fox, 1993
  • Rachelle, "The Girl Who Cried Baby," Empty Nest, NBC, 1993
  • Mrs. Rathke, "Fred Runs Away," The Boys Are Back, CBS, 1994
  • Annette, "A Dime a Dance," Fallen Angels, Showtime, 1995
  • Reema, "The Importance of Being Ernie," The Home Court, NBC, 1996
  • Loan officer, "Toil and Trouble," Beverly Hills, 90210, Fox, 1997
  • Claire, "Dick Solomon of the Indiana Solomons," 3rd Rock from the Sun (also known as Life As We Know It), NBC, 1999
  • Instructor, "Cutting the Cord," Boy Meets World, ABC, 1999
  • Mrs. Fields, "Deserving Honors," The Parent 'Hood, The WB, 1999
  • Rhonda Phillips, "Assaulted Nuts," The King of Queens, CBS, 1999
  • Dr. Priscilla Nagler, "Have I Got a Deal for You," Chicago Hope, CBS, 2000
  • Dr. Priscilla Nagler, "Miller Time," Chicago Hope, CBS, 2000
  • Martha, "... Or Not to Be," Bette, CBS, 2000
  • Carrie, "Bernie Mac, Ladies Man," The Bernie Mac Show, Fox, 2001
  • Elise Stevens, "Thy Will Be Done," ER (also known as EmergencyRoom), NBC, 2001
  • Claire, "Family Reunion," Malcolm in the Middle, Fox, 2002
  • Mary Beth White, "The Wedding Planner," Providence, NBC, 2002
  • Casting director, "Gun of a Son," 10-8: Officers on Duty (also known as 10-8), ABC, 2003
  • Voice characterization in King of the Hill (animated), Fox.
  • Other
  • Appliance salesperson, "Fence Neighbors," The Torkelsons (pilot),NBC, 1991
  • Young woman, Plymouth (pilot), ABC, 1991
  • Cruel Doubt (miniseries), NBC, 1992
  • Betsy Gordon, What's Right with America (special), CBS, 1997
  • Film Appearances
  • Helen Gray, Zelig, Orion/Warner Bros., 1983
  • Technician, Scrooged, Paramount, 1988
  • Redhead, Fearless, Warner Bros., 1993
  • Market mother, Mother's Boys, Dimension Films, 1994
  • Jenny, The Craft, Columbia/TriStar, 1996
  • Woman, Pleasantville, New Line Cinema, 1998
  • Jo Metzler, Election, Paramount, 1999
  • National Enquirer reporter, Man on the Moon (also known asDer Mondmann), Universal, 1999
  • Principal Biggs, Blast, Velocity Home Entertainment, 2000
  • Dr. Hassler, Red Dragon (also known as Roter Drache), Metro-Goldwyn-Mayer, 2002
